AC Milan plans to move its Serie A home match against Como next February to Perth, Australia, which has triggered strong opposition from players. Milan captain Maignan publicly stated that the move put financial interests ahead of competitive fairness, was the wrong decision, and caused his team to "lose" a home advantage.

Maignan's views on this controversial event

"I completely agree with Rabiot. I don't understand why we have to go abroad to play. Now a lot of things have been forgotten, and we think too much about the financial aspect. This is an Italian league game, and I don't understand why we have to play abroad. More importantly, we should have played at home, so we 'lost' a home court. Our goals are ambitious and we must not take any chances."

"I was very surprised when I heard that we were going to play a Serie A match with AC Milan in Australia. It was completely crazy. But these are financial agreements to raise the profile of the league and are things we have no control over. There is a lot of talk about the schedule and player health and it all seems really ridiculous. It's crazy to fly so far to play a game between two Italian teams in Australia. We have to adapt as usual."
